According to the Observer, gambling sites and casinos are seriously considering dropping the ability to bet on WWE matches. They pretty much are aware who are insiders in the WWE and WWE wrestlers who bet a lot on their own matches.

SummerSlam could be the final straw since the losses were huge for at least one gambling company.

Quote:

Originally Posted by Observer
There was someone who gets all the WWE finishes that made a killing at SummerSlam because not enough smart money came for them to adjust the line, and also, none of the actual finishes were changed at the last minute. He did a $3.36 parlay on ten matches, all of which he got right, and won $45,600. That was a key thing where I mentioned after the show that a lot of the gambling sites were considering dropping WWE because insiders that knew could make a lot of money and that level money was ridiculous. The company that got hammered hasn’t done parlays in a long time, and won’t be doing them again. It was noted that the one guy alone may kill the landscape because companies don’t want to open themselves up for those kind of losses in what is usually considered a minor fun thing of having odds on pro wrestling matches. It also should be noted that there are WWE talents betting heavily which is where some sites recognize and switch the odds when those bets come in
